De-caffeinated Blade Runner
28 June 2022
Music similar to Vangellis, synthetic beings and emotions. It feels like Blade Runner, but without action, epic lines, futuristic worlds and people hunting synthetics.

So what is left? There's a great cast. They really do discuss relationships between people and synthetics a lot, lots of moody moments and things to ponder. However, unlike other romantic films I didn't really care if they got together. Zoe whether a real person or synthetic is physically beautiful, but the conversation between her and Ewan McGregors character is all whispery and lacking in flirtatiousness. Was this meant to be? If so she played it perfectly, but either way the romance is neither here nor there. There's no action so overall this film is just a bit long and odd.
